Over the past 27 years, there have been 11 property sales recorded in the L12 4YD postcode area. The highest sale price reached £110,000, while the most recent sale was for a semi-detached flat sold in August 2019 for £50,000.
The estimated average property value in L12 4YD currently stands at £100,135, which is approximately 60.7% lower than the city average - making it a relatively affordable option for buyers.
In terms of size, the average price per square metre is approximately £1,812.
Property prices in L12 4YD have risen by 8.8% over the past year , with a total increase of 52.2% over the past five years, and a long-term rise of 87.2% over the past decade.
The most common type of property sold in the area is semi-detached, making up around 55% of transactions , followed by terraced and flat.
Housing in L12 4YD is predominantly owner-occupied, with an estimated 66% of homes being lived in by the owners.
